German federal police searched properties in four states in a major raid against members of a smuggling gang. As a spokesperson for the Federal Ministry of the Interior announced upon request, the operation included the execution of several European arrest warrants on Wednesday morning in North Rhine-Westphalia, Hesse, Bavaria and Schleswig-Holstein.

Police authorities in France and Belgium were also said to be involved. The suspects are said to have been involved in smuggling across the English Channel. The focus is on North Rhine-Westphalia.

Hundreds of officers on duty

A spokesperson for the federal police in North Rhine-Westphalia confirmed the large-scale operation, coordinated by Europol, to the German news agency. This is to combat smuggling crime and the unauthorized entry of migrants into Britain by boat across the English Channel. The federal police did not want to comment on the number of people arrested because the operation is still ongoing. About 700 emergency services were involved in the raid and searches at more than twenty locations in North Rhine-Westphalia. Europol will make the final assessment on Thursday, the spokesperson said.

The European Union Police Authority confirmed that it involved an operation in several European countries. Details about the operation would not be announced until the afternoon, a spokeswoman in The Hague said. (SDA)
